Understanding Your Hey Dude Shoes
Before diving into the cleaning process, it’s essential to understand the materials and construction of Hey Dude shoes. Most Hey Dude shoes feature a combination of breathable fabric uppers, cushioned insoles, and lightweight outsoles. While this makes them incredibly comfortable, it also means they require special care when cleaning to avoid damaging these materials.
Cleaning Supplies You’ll Need
Before you begin cleaning your Hey Dude shoes, gather the following supplies:
Mild detergent or shoe cleaner
Soft-bristled brush or sponge
Water
Towel
Optional: Shoe deodorizer
With these supplies on hand, you’re ready to start the cleaning process.
Step-by-Step Cleaning Process
Follow these steps to clean your Hey Dude shoes effectively:
Remove Laces: Start by removing the laces from your shoes. This will allow you to clean both the fabric uppers and the laces more thoroughly.
Brush Away Surface Dirt: Use a soft-bristled brush or sponge to gently brush away any surface dirt or debris from the shoes. Be careful not to scrub too vigorously, as this could damage the fabric or stitching.
Prepare Cleaning Solution: In a bowl, mix a small amount of mild detergent or shoe cleaner with water to create a cleaning solution. Be sure to use a gentle detergent to avoid damaging the fabric.
Spot Clean Stains: Dip the brush or sponge into the cleaning solution and gently spot clean any stains or areas of heavy soiling on the shoes. Work the solution into the fabric in a circular motion, being careful not to saturate the material.
Clean the Insoles: If your Hey Dude shoes have removable insoles, take them out and clean them separately. Use the same cleaning solution and a soft brush to gently scrub away any dirt or odor.
Rinse Thoroughly: Once you’ve spot cleaned the shoes, rinse them thoroughly with clean water to remove any remaining soap residue.
Air Dry: After rinsing, gently squeeze out any excess water from the shoes and insoles. Then, place them in a well-ventilated area to air dry completely. Avoid using direct heat sources, such as a hairdryer, as this can damage the materials.
Re-lace and Deodorize: Once your Hey Dude shoes are completely dry, re-lace them and consider using a shoe deodorizer to keep them smelling fresh.
Tips for Maintenance
To keep your Hey Dude shoes looking and feeling their best, consider these maintenance tips:
Regular Cleaning: Make it a habit to spot clean your Hey Dude shoes regularly, especially after outdoor activities or heavy use.
Protective Spray: Consider applying a water and stain repellent spray to your Hey Dude shoes to help protect them from spills and stains.
Air Them Out: After wearing your Hey Dude shoes, remove them and allow them to air out to prevent odor buildup.
Rotate Your Shoes: Avoid wearing the same pair of Hey Dude shoes every day. Rotate between multiple pairs to give each pair time to air out and prolong their lifespan.
Store Them Properly: When not in use, store your Hey Dude shoes in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ent fading and deterioration.
